Question 847433: Ana's age is 4 more than Lisa's age. Write an expression, that represents the sum of their ages using L as the variable for Lisa's age.

Let
A = Ana's age
L = Lisa's age


"Ana's age is 4 more than Lisa's age"

turns into

Ana's age = (Lisa's Age) + 4

Now replace those phrases with what they defined by (see above) to get

A = L + 4

So lisa is L years old and ana is L+4 years old.

Add the two ages

(Ana's age) + (Lisa's age)

(L+4) + (L)

L + 4 + L

(L + L) + 4

2L + 4

is the sum of their two ages
